WebRockfall talus —produced mainly by rockfall (individual blocks falling, shattering, rolling, bouncing); there is a high percentage of coarse blocks, with fine sizes in the minority; larger sizes occur at the bottom of 37°-40° slopes; freeze-thaw and heavy rain releases the blocks; rarely associated with vegetation.
